Large Bird Feeder - Deciding On Which Of The Different Kinds Of Feeders To Use For Different Purposes

Using a large bird feeder is a wonderful way to take advantage of the colorful species of wild birds that live around you. But if there are only specific species that you wish to bring in then you need to take certain steps to ensure you successfully attract the ones you like.

Smaller birds like all kinds of feeders and will eat out of anything. But larger birds may have a hard time resting on a little perch and may decide that it is not worth the effort. This will diminish the number of overall wild birds you attract to your large bird feeder. If the goal is to only attract smaller birds like finches or sparrows then a homeowner can choose a model that is specifically created for these species.

If you find that squirrels are ravaging a feeder, then the best choice is to purchase a tube feeder. These are a deterrent for squirrels so they typically will not bother one. Plus, if you are aiming for smaller kinds of birds then this is the perfect style since larger ones normally cannot access such bird feeders.

If a homeowner likes to attract any type of wildlife that wants to eat then the best option is a platform style feeder. These are mounted on poles and provide a bounty for any animal that can access it. This could involve chipmunks, squirrels and all types of birds - even crows. Be cautious where this is placed since it will need to be within reach for refilling and cleaning. Things might also get quite raucous with the competition between the feeders. Near a bedroom is probably not a good idea.

One important thing that most homeowners forget when mounting a food source is to also include a water source, too. This will maximize the number of birds, and other animals if that is your wish, that partake of the food.

Another popular style of large bird feeder is the hopper feeder. It is larger and has a lid that comes off for easier filling. As it is a bigger size it is also simpler to clean. This is important, no matter what type you decide to buy. Old food can accumulate moisture and soon mold, which is harmful to birds, and in some cases, can even kill them. Plus, if it spoils just after filling then a significant amount of food is wasted.

Whichever type of bird feeder you acquire, you will definitely have hours of bird watching to entertain you.
